Let me just give you all some context to this so that everyone understands better, because I know the industry very well and I have met El-Erian once. El-Erian is a 56 year old man who has made soooo much money, he can't even spend half of it in his life time. In 2011 alone he made $100 million and over the last ten year he must have made over $500 million. So he can happily retire now at 56 because how much longer does he even have left.

The real reason he resigned is that he had a big fallout with the founder of the company and they even engaged in insults publicly, moreover his firm is under investigation by SEC so its probably a good time to resign and just spend more time with his family.

But I believe his daughter's list is real and that is the point I want to make. There is a price to pay for everything in life. If you want to get to the very top of your career, make millions in business, establish a billion dollar firm, there is a price to pay. Go ask Dangote or Adenuga or Otudeko or Elumelu or Imokhuede's children how often they see their fathers. Those guys that run multinationals or huge firms dont work 9am - 5pm. They work more like 6am - 11pm if not more. They just pay the price.

I had a personal experience last year; myself and a friend whose dad is very wealthy and influential in Nigeria wanted to go into business together. We needed his dad's connections for easy entry so we booked a meeting to see his dad. It took us three days of waiting before we finally saw his dad. Three days to see the man. He was just always busy and in one meeting or the other. I couldnt believe it.

So all the women that want to marry billionnaires and rich men need to understand that these guys are always on the move, wouldnt help with kids or house work and infact, they may leave alot of the parenting to you alone.
